Output abd28aa4ba5c79683f70a1ce01f3c665cf41092eac368ba65cdc88d0f648613d:2

value
849662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ad16663586db5448abb477bf4ce5b2cacd3cf3b2 OP_EQUAL
address
3HUDf4JyxHY4ipCSRuuUtUCKPyoJYN69pR
transaction
abd28aa4ba5c79683f70a1ce01f3c665cf41092eac368ba65cdc88d0f648613d
spent
true